てなる溶接スラブ用受け具。[Claims for Utility Model Registration] (1) An inverted umbrella-shaped slab guiding body 10 made of a heat-resistant material and having a tapered welding slab guiding surface 12 on the inner peripheral surface is provided, and the top of the slab guiding body 10 is A slab guide hole 18 is formed,
The welding slab receiver is provided with a removable heat-resistant slab receiver 16 below the slab guide hole 18. (2) An inverted umbrella-shaped foldable slab guide body 10 made of a heat-resistant material is provided with a tapered welded slab guide surface 12 on the inner peripheral surface, and a slab guide hole 18 is provided at the top of the slab guide body 10. A receptacle for welding slabs in which a removable heat-resistant slab receptacle 16 is provided below the slab guide hole 18.
